MOOCs and Open Education Around the World. 2015 – Routledge.
Edited by Curtis J. Bonk, Mimi M. Lee, Thomas C. Reeves, Thomas H. Reynolds.
Find out more about this educative new book MOOCs and Open Education
MOOCs and Open Education Around the World is a
edited collection
that
considers
topics
regarding open
educational resources
(OERs) and
massively open online courses (MOOC).
Recent
changes in
online learning technology make it possible for
people
in nations all aver the world
to take courses online.
These online MOOCs are
commonly free
for students but do not
lead to formal accreditation.
